Adding REST API to Your Module
This tutorial extends the Notes module from Getting-Started-with-XOOPS-4.0-Module-Development by adding a complete REST API. You’ll learn API design patterns, JSON responses, authentication, and error handling.
What We’re Building
Section titled “What We’re Building”A RESTful API for the Notes module with:
- CRUD endpoints for notes
- JSON request/response handling
- JWT-based authentication
- Proper HTTP status codes
- API versioning
- Rate limiting
- OpenAPI documentation
API Design Overview
Section titled “API Design Overview”Base URL: /modules/notes/api/v1
Endpoints:GET /notes List user's notesPOST /notes Create a new noteGET /notes/{id} Get a single notePUT /notes/{id} Update a notePATCH /notes/{id} Partial updateDELETE /notes/{id} Delete a notePOST /notes/{id}/archive Archive a notePOST /notes/{id}/restore Restore from archiveGET /notes/search Search notesPart 1: API Infrastructure
Section titled “Part 1: API Infrastructure”Step 1: Create the API Router
Section titled “Step 1: Create the API Router”<?php
declare(strict_types=1);
namespace Notes\Infrastructure\Api;
/** * Router - Simple REST API router. * * Routes incoming requests to appropriate handlers based on * HTTP method and URL pattern. */final class Router{ /** @var array<string, array<string, callable>> */ private array $routes = [];
/** * Register a GET route. */ public function get(string $pattern, callable $handler): self { return $this->addRoute('GET', $pattern, $handler); }
/** * Register a POST route. */ public function post(string $pattern, callable $handler): self { return $this->addRoute('POST', $pattern, $handler); }
/** * Register a PUT route. */ public function put(string $pattern, callable $handler): self { return $this->addRoute('PUT', $pattern, $handler); }
/** * Register a PATCH route. */ public function patch(string $pattern, callable $handler): self { return $this->addRoute('PATCH', $pattern, $handler); }
/** * Register a DELETE route. */ public function delete(string $pattern, callable $handler): self { return $this->addRoute('DELETE', $pattern, $handler); }
/** * Dispatch the current request. */ public function dispatch(string $method, string $path): mixed { $method = strtoupper($method);
if (!isset($this->routes[$method])) { throw new HttpException(405, 'Method Not Allowed'); }
foreach ($this->routes[$method] as $pattern => $handler) { $params = $this->match($pattern, $path);
if ($params !== null) { return $handler(...$params); } }
throw new HttpException(404, 'Not Found'); }
private function addRoute(string $method, string $pattern, callable $handler): self { $this->routes[$method][$pattern] = $handler; return $this; }
/** * Match a URL pattern against a path. * * Patterns use {param} syntax for path parameters. * Returns array of matched parameters or null if no match. */ private function match(string $pattern, string $path): ?array { // Convert {param} to named capture groups $regex = preg_replace('/\{(\w+)\}/', '(?P<$1>[^/]+)', $pattern); $regex = '#^' . $regex . '$#';
if (preg_match($regex, $path, $matches)) { // Return only named captures return array_filter($matches, 'is_string', ARRAY_FILTER_USE_KEY); }
return null; }}Step 2: Create HTTP Exception Classes

Section titled “Part 2: Authentication”Step 5: Create JWT Authentication
Section titled “Step 5: Create JWT Authentication”<?php
declare(strict_types=1);
namespace Notes\Infrastructure\Api\Auth;
/** * JwtAuth - Simple JWT authentication. * * In production, use a library like firebase/php-jwt. * This is a simplified implementation for learning. */final class JwtAuth{ private const ALGORITHM = 'HS256';
public function __construct( private readonly string $secretKey, private readonly int $ttl = 3600 // 1 hour ) {}
/** * Generate a JWT token for a user. */ public function generateToken(int $userId, array $claims = []): string { $header = [ 'typ' => 'JWT', 'alg' => self::ALGORITHM, ];
$payload = array_merge($claims, [ 'sub' => $userId, 'iat' => time(), 'exp' => time() + $this->ttl, ]);
$headerEncoded = $this->base64UrlEncode(json_encode($header)); $payloadEncoded = $this->base64UrlEncode(json_encode($payload));
$signature = $this->sign("{$headerEncoded}.{$payloadEncoded}"); $signatureEncoded = $this->base64UrlEncode($signature);
return "{$headerEncoded}.{$payloadEncoded}.{$signatureEncoded}"; }
/** * Verify and decode a JWT token. * * @return array The payload claims * @throws UnauthorizedException If token is invalid */ public function verifyToken(string $token): array { $parts = explode('.', $token);
if (count($parts) !== 3) { throw new UnauthorizedException('Invalid token format'); }
[$headerEncoded, $payloadEncoded, $signatureEncoded] = $parts;
// Verify signature $expectedSignature = $this->sign("{$headerEncoded}.{$payloadEncoded}");
if (!hash_equals($this->base64UrlEncode($expectedSignature), $signatureEncoded)) { throw new UnauthorizedException('Invalid token signature'); }
// Decode payload $payload = json_decode($this->base64UrlDecode($payloadEncoded), true);
if (!$payload) { throw new UnauthorizedException('Invalid token payload'); }
// Check expiration if (isset($payload['exp']) && $payload['exp'] < time()) { throw new UnauthorizedException('Token has expired'); }
return $payload; }
/** * Get user ID from token. */ public function getUserId(string $token): int { $payload = $this->verifyToken($token); return (int) ($payload['sub'] ?? 0); }
private function sign(string $data): string { return hash_hmac('sha256', $data, $this->secretKey, true); }
private function base64UrlEncode(string $data): string { return rtrim(strtr(base64_encode($data), '+/', '-_'), '='); }
private function base64UrlDecode(string $data): string { return base64_decode(strtr($data, '-_', '+/')); }}Step 6: Create Authentication Middleware

Section titled “Part 6: Rate Limiting”Step 12: Add Rate Limiting Middleware
Section titled “Step 12: Add Rate Limiting Middleware”<?php
declare(strict_types=1);
namespace Notes\Infrastructure\Api\Middleware;
use Notes\Infrastructure\Api\HttpException;
/** * RateLimitMiddleware - Prevents API abuse. * * Uses a simple sliding window algorithm with file-based storage. * In production, use Redis for distributed rate limiting. */final class RateLimitMiddleware{ public function __construct( private readonly int $maxRequests = 60, private readonly int $windowSeconds = 60, private readonly string $storagePath = '/tmp/rate_limits' ) { if (!is_dir($this->storagePath)) { mkdir($this->storagePath, 0755, true); } }
/** * Check if request should be rate limited. * * @throws HttpException 429 Too Many Requests */ public function check(string $identifier): void { $file = $this->getStorageFile($identifier); $now = time(); $windowStart = $now - $this->windowSeconds;
// Read existing timestamps $timestamps = $this->readTimestamps($file);
// Filter to current window $timestamps = array_filter($timestamps, fn($t) => $t > $windowStart);
// Check limit if (count($timestamps) >= $this->maxRequests) { $retryAfter = min($timestamps) + $this->windowSeconds - $now;
throw new HttpException( statusCode: 429, message: 'Too Many Requests', errors: [ 'retry_after' => $retryAfter, 'limit' => $this->maxRequests, 'window' => $this->windowSeconds, ] ); }
// Add current timestamp $timestamps[] = $now; $this->writeTimestamps($file, $timestamps); }
/** * Get remaining requests in current window. */ public function getRemaining(string $identifier): int { $file = $this->getStorageFile($identifier); $windowStart = time() - $this->windowSeconds;
$timestamps = $this->readTimestamps($file); $timestamps = array_filter($timestamps, fn($t) => $t > $windowStart);
return max(0, $this->maxRequests - count($timestamps)); }
private function getStorageFile(string $identifier): string { return $this->storagePath . '/' . md5($identifier) . '.json'; }
private function readTimestamps(string $file): array { if (!file_exists($file)) { return []; }
$content = file_get_contents($file); return json_decode($content, true) ?? []; }
private function writeTimestamps(string $file, array $timestamps): void { file_put_contents($file, json_encode(array_values($timestamps))); }}Part 7: OpenAPI Documentation

API Usage Example
Section titled “API Usage Example”# Logincurl -X POST /modules/notes/api/v1/auth/login \ -H "Content-Type: application/json" \ -d '{"username":"admin","password":"secret"}'
# Create notecurl -X POST /modules/notes/api/v1/notes \ -H "Authorization: Bearer <token>" \ -H "Content-Type: application/json" \ -d '{"title":"My Note","content":"Hello world"}'
# List notescurl /modules/notes/api/v1/notes \ -H "Authorization: Bearer <token>"
# Searchcurl "/modules/notes/api/v1/notes/search?q=hello" \ -H "Authorization: Bearer <token>"Related Documentation
